This is a quick and easy way to make a sweet shortcrust pastry for mince pies, jam tarts and other tasty treats. You can make this and keep it in the fridge for a couple of days, or freeze it until you need it.

Made this tonight as we had some wraps to use – the kids demolished it, and it was really quick and simple. You can use whatever you fancy to fill it – tomato pasta sauce, garlic mushrooms, beef, chilli, chicken… anything you like! I used a tomato, red onion, basil and lentil filling along with the cheese.
